Iran’s Supreme Leader Thanks Funeral Crowds, Vows Retaliation for Slain Predecessor

Iran’s Supreme Leader, Ayatollah Seyyed Mujtaba Khamenei, has expressed gratitude for the massive public turnout at the funeral ceremonies for his father and predecessor, Martyred Ayatollah Seyyed Ali Khamenei, describing the gatherings as “astonishing, enemy-breaking and historic.” In a message released after the ceremonies, he praised millions of mourners who participated across cities in Iran and Iraq.
The leader specifically thanked people in Tehran, Qom, Mashhad, Najaf and Karbala for attending the funeral processions, saying the large crowds reflected continued support for the late leader’s legacy. He characterized the participation as a significant demonstration of public unity and resilience during a period of national mourning.
In his statement, Ayatollah Mujtaba Khamenei also pledged retaliation for the Martyrdom of Ayatollah Ali Khamenei and others martyred during the recent conflicts. Referring to those responsible as “criminal and disgraced murderers,” he said that avenging the slain leader and other victims was certain.
Addressing his late father directly, the new supreme leader vowed to preserve and continue his predecessor’s path. He said the nation would remain committed to the principles established under Martyred Ayatollah Ali Khamenei’s leadership, emphasizing perseverance through hardships and trust in God’s promises.
The message comes as Iran enters a new phase of leadership following the Martyrdom of Ayatollah Ali Khamenei. The funeral ceremonies drew large crowds in both Iran and Iraq, marking one of the most significant public events in the region in recent years, while the leadership’s pledge of retaliation is expected to draw continued international attention.
